数据库游标在服务器端编程中的使用:处理大量数据的技巧​
行业新闻 2025-10-06 22:20 153

活动:桔子数据-爆款香港服务器,CTG+CN2高速带宽、快速稳定、平均延迟10+ms 速度快,免备案,每月仅需19元!! 点击查看

数据库游标在服务器端编程中的使用:处理大量数据的技巧​

数据库游标在服务器端编程中的使用:处理大量数据的技巧

一、引言

在现代服务器端编程中,处理大量数据是一个常见的挑战。数据库游标作为一种重要的数据处理工具,能够有效帮助开发者处理和管理大规模数据。本文将深入探讨数据库游标在服务器端编程中的应用,并分享一些处理大量数据的技巧。

二、数据库游标的基本概念

数据库游标是一个用于从数据库表中检索数据的工具。它可以定位到表的特定行,按特定顺序访问表中的行,并在需要时更改数据。对于处理大量数据,游标提供了一种灵活且高效的方式。

三、数据库游标在服务器端的应用

1. 数据分批处理

当需要处理大量数据时,一次性加载所有数据可能导致内存不足。通过使用游标,可以将数据分批加载到内存中,逐批处理,有效避免内存溢出问题。

2. 实时数据处理

数据库游标可以实时读取数据变更,这对于需要实时响应的服务器应用非常重要。例如,在社交媒体应用中,可以使用游标追踪新发布的内容,并实时将其展示给用户。

3. 数据过滤和优化

通过游标的灵活定位,开发者可以仅加载所需的数据。例如,仅加载数据库中满足特定条件的行,这大大提高了数据处理效率。

四、桔子数据服务器推荐

在处理大量数据时,选择高性能的服务器是关键。桔子数据提供的服务器具有出色的计算能力和大规模数据存储能力,非常适合处理大规模数据场景。其高效的I/O性能和稳定的网络连接保证了数据处理的效率和速度。

五、使用数据库游标的技巧

1. 合理使用游标

避免在不需要的地方使用游标,例如在简单的查询中。只在真正需要逐行处理数据时使用游标。

2. 优化查询语句

使用游标前,先优化查询语句,确保只获取所需的数据。

3. 注意内存管理

使用游标处理数据时,要注意内存管理,避免内存泄漏和溢出。

六、总结

数据库游标在服务器端编程中处理大量数据时具有显著优势。通过合理使用和优化,结合高性能的服务器,可以有效提高数据处理效率。桔子数据提供的服务器为开发者提供了一个优秀的选择,帮助他们在处理大规模数据时获得更好的性能。

标签:

  • 提取的关键词是:数据库游标
  • 服务器端编程
  • 处理大量数据
  • 桔子数据服务器
  • 技巧